How to Use the Tool

Using the Paired Triads tool is simple and intuitive. Follow these steps to start exploring paired triads.

  1. Step 1: Select a starting triad from the available triad library. This allows you to set the foundation of your harmonic exploration.
  2. Step 2: Explore the pairable triads that can be combined with your starting triad. The tool will visually show you the available options.
  3. Step 3: Observe the harmonic relationships between the triad pairs to understand how they interact and complement each other.
  4. Step 4: Visualize both triads on the guitar fretboard for a clear understanding of their positioning and integration.
  5. Step 5: Listen to the resulting harmonic color by playing the triads together or separately. This will help you choose the combinations that best suit your compositions.
  6. Step 6: Analyze the hexatonic scale created by your paired triads to discover new melodic and harmonic possibilities.

For example, if you’re working on a piece in C major, you can select a C triad and explore pairing it with D or E triads to enrich your progression.
